Marli Huijer & Frank Meester (april 2012)

In this book Huijer and Meester bridge the gap between academic philosophy and public philosophy. Academic philosophy studies the work of the great philosophers with great dedication, public philosophy makes philosophy applicable to actuality. This book is an outing of Huijers drive to make philosophy accessible for people of all layers of society. Questions that are presented in the book: What can John Stuart Mill tell us about our weekly department meeting? Can Foucault give us tips on how to deal with power struggles at work? And what can Charles Darwin learn us about sustainability?
